Introduction

Children's science books play a crucial role in fostering curiosity and a love for learning in young minds. These books are tailored to capture the imagination of children while imparting essential scientific knowledge. With vibrant illustrations, relatable characters, and simple explanations, children's science books make complex topics accessible and enjoyable.

Parents and educators often seek out these books to enhance children's understanding of the world around them. Topics can range from biology and chemistry to physics and environmental science, ensuring that there is something for every young reader. Here are some reasons why children's science books are invaluable:
  • Promote critical thinking skills
  • Encourage exploration and experimentation
  • Introduce foundational scientific terminology
  • Inspire a lifelong interest in science

As children delve into these books, they encounter fascinating facts and experiments that ignite their imagination. Whether it's learning about the solar system, the human body, or the wonders of nature, children's science books provide a solid foundation for future learning.

By selecting high-quality children's science books, parents can ensure that their children are not only entertained but also educated. Look for books that match your child's age and interests, and consider those with engaging illustrations and interactive elements.

Key features include age-appropriate language, captivating visuals, accurate information, and activities or questions to stimulate further exploration.

A common mistake is choosing books that are too advanced or too simplistic for the child's current understanding, which can lead to frustration or disinterest.
